First 802.11ac WLAN Platform Running Application-Aware Software

Freescale Semiconductor has demonstrated the first QorIQ P1020 reference platform for 802.11ac that simultaneously delivers “gigabit Wi-Fi” while running application identification software required for security and core network offload in next-generation wireless local area network products. The turnkey reference platform underscores Freescale’s continued leadership in the wireless access space, which Infonetics projects to grow at 12 percent CAGR through 2017.
QorIQ communications processors from Freescale have been selected to power solutions for eight of the top 10 manufacturers of enterprise wireless access point equipment.

A key WLAN growth driver is the bring your own device phenomenon, which requires enterprise and service provider networks to manage known users, as well as network guests who may not have the same privileges to access sensitive content. These access and quality of service challenges, together with the demanding performance requirements of gigabit-rate 802.11ac technology and increasing access issues stemming from the introduction of myriad personal wireless devices into the network, combine to present daunting challenges to WLAN equipment OEMs and network administrators.

Freescale’s WLAN reference platform comprehends and addresses these challenges by combining highly advanced 802.11ac radios with Freescale’s new VortiQa application identification software and the exceptional processing performance of QorIQ P1020 communications processors. VortiQa AIS detects more than 1,200 applications and is equipped with comprehensive signature distribution infrastructure.

The platform runs on symmetric multiprocessing Linux leveraging the multicore QorIQ P1020 communications processor, thereby lowering CPU utilization and providing optimal performance for differentiation within application-level software.

“Freescale’s 802.11ac WLAN reference platform delivers the processing headroom to support real-world applications while driving impressive 802.11ac performance,” said Tareq Bustami, vice president of product management for Freescale’s Digital Networking business. “By offloading processing-intensive application identification tasks at the wireless network's edge, the platform helps dramatically reduce centralized 40 Gbps link bottlenecks, thereby enabling optimized and balanced network loading.”
